About Barangay Sinawal

Classified as a barangay, Barangay Sinawal is one of the administrative divisions of City of General Santos in South Cotabato, SOCCSKSARGEN, Philippines.

Detailed 2020 population figures for Barangay Sinawal are being compiled from official census tables. For context, the City of General Santos contains 26 barangays in total.

City of General Santos is a city comprising 26 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Sinawal,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. The province of South Cotabato contains numerous barangays across its component cities and municipalities, with Barangay Sinawal forming part of City of General Santos's local administrative structure. South Cotabato is classified as a 1st by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.

Barangay Sinawal is governed by an elected Sangguniang Barangay composed of a Punong Barangay and seven kagawads, with the Sangguniang Kabataan representing the youth. The next BSKE, set for Monday, November 2, 2026, will elect officials to four-year terms as provided under Republic Act No. 12232.

Contact Information & Officials

✓ Verified
Phone
1
Punong Barangay
Eduardo Waban Bantilan(2023 - 2026 term)
Barangay Secretary
Lean Dave Tamay Monday
Barangay Treasurer
Daniel Munday Bungan
SK Chairperson
Joven Mae Orca Cadungog

Sangguniang Barangay Members (Kagawads)

  • Minda Lozano Atendido
  • James Eric Bangon Talawi
  • April Joy Eduvas Bobis
  • Ceazar Vernardine Gutierrez Lozano
  • Dominador Olarte Lozano
  • Jerry Tadios Menson
  • Michael Petalino Cellan
Important: Officials shown here reflect the 2023 - 2026 term. Barangay leadership can change due to resignation, succession, or special circumstances.
